Japan Talk #161

One Comment

  1. Japundit says:

    Story added…

    Your story has been featured on Japundit! Here is the link: http://www.japundit.com/Japundit/Japan_Talk_Podcast_161...

Leave a Reply

You must be logged in to post a comment.